Central Arizona College ADN program


I just signed up to attend CAC today and I was wondering if any of you fellow ALLNURSES members have ever gone through this program? From what I understand (mathematically anyway ) is that it would take me two years (that's including pre-reqs and CAC has no waitlist luckily!!!!) 7 semesters (I'm starting this Summer 09 ending in Summer 11) so it seems like a good deal so far. From what I understand, I will also gain CNA certification and my EMT license along the way. If any of you have done this nursing program, I'm really interested to hear what you have to say! Thanks for reading, I hope to hear from some of you

Default Re: Central Arizona College ADN program
I am currently in the nursing program right now. Unless you specifically enroll in the EMS class (which is separate from the Nursing program), you aren't able to get your certification. You can however get you LPN after the first year of the program and an LPN course.
